Top 5 problems with Škoda Octavia with mileage: what to look for first
Even the most reliable Škoda Octavia after 100–150 thousand kilometers it begins to require attention. We have compiled a list critical nodes, which most often fail, based on data from Ufa service centers and owner reviews on Drive2.ru:
- 🔧 Gearbox DSG-7 (dry clutch): On cars before 2017, the clutch life rarely exceeds 100 thousand km. Symptoms: jerking when switching, burning smell, error
P17BF. Replacement will cost 80–120 thousand rubles. - 💧 Oil pump 1.4/1.8 TSI: With a mileage of over 120 thousand km, there is a risk of oil starvation due to wear on the timing chain. Signs: knocking when cold, oil pressure light. The solution is to replace the pump + chain (from 50 thousand rubles).
- ⚡ Electronics (ABS sensors, climate control): Particularly vulnerable Octavia A5 and early A7. The throttle position sensor often fails (
P2135) — repair cost from 5 thousand rubles. - 🔩 Suspension (struts, silent blocks): The rear shock absorbers are enough for 80–100 thousand km, the front silent blocks are enough for 60–80 thousand km. A complete replacement of the suspension will cost 40–60 thousand rubles.
- 🔥 Turbine (1.8/2.0 TSI): The service life is 150–200 thousand km, but if the oil is changed irregularly, it may fail earlier. Symptoms: smoke from the exhaust, loss of power. Repair from 70 thousand rubles.
⚠️ Attention: If the ad on Avito indicates mileage less than 10 thousand km per year (for example, 50 thousand km in 2015–2026), this is almost always a sign of twisting. Average real mileage for Octavia in Bashkortostan - 15–20 thousand km/year. You can check the integrity of your mileage through services Autocode or CarVertical, but it’s better to check the maintenance records (if they exist).

How to check a Škoda Octavia by VIN: step-by-step instructions
Each Škoda Octavia has a unique VIN code, by which you can find out real mileage, accident history, number of owners and even was the car in a taxi?. In Bashkortostan, checking by VIN is mandatory - this will help you avoid buying a problem car. Here's how to do it:
- Find VIN: It is indicated in the STS, PTS, on a plate under the hood (driver's side) or on the dashboard on the windshield side.
- Check through the official Škoda service:
- Go to the site
www.skoda-auto.ru/owners/service-history/. - Enter VIN and owner details (if available).
- The system will show the maintenance history of official dealers.
- Go to the site
- Use paid services:
Autocode(from 349 rubles) - will show accidents, traffic police restrictions, mileage.CarVertical(from 599 rubles) - will give data from Europe if the car was imported.
traffic police.rf/check/auto) by VIN or license plate number.⚠️ Attention: If the report Autocode or CarVertical mileage indicated significantly lowerthan in the ad on Avito, this is a sure sign of twisting. For example, if the seller claims 80 thousand km, but the report shows 150 thousand km, it is better to refuse such a car. You should also be wary if there are large gaps in the maintenance history (for example, there are no records for 3-4 years).

The best and worst configurations of the Škoda Octavia for Bashkortostan
When choosing Škoda Octavia in the secondary market it is important to take into account not only the technical condition, but also complete set. Some options make the car more comfortable for use in Bashkortostan (for example, heated steering wheel in winter or rear view camera for parking in Ufa), while others only increase the cost of repairs. We analyzed the demand and reliability of different versions:
- ✅ Best options:
- Ambition (A7/A8): Optimal price/equipment ratio. Includes climate control, heated seats, multimedia
Bolero. - Style (A7 FL/A8): Adds LED headlights, rearview camera, leather interior. Ideal for the city.
- Scout (A7): Increased ground clearance (170 mm), engine protection. Relevant for rural areas.
- Ambition (A7/A8): Optimal price/equipment ratio. Includes climate control, heated seats, multimedia
- ❌ Problematic configurations:
- Active (basic): There isn't even air conditioning or power windows. It will be difficult to resell.
- RS with DSG-7: Powerful engine (220+ hp) + robot = high risk of breakdowns during aggressive driving.
- Modifications with diesel 2.0 TDI: In Bashkortostan it is difficult to find spare parts and repairmen.
💡 Selection advice: If you buy Octavia for families and frequent trips along the Ufa-Moscow highway, pay attention to the versions with an engine 1.8 TSI and DSG-6 (wet clutch). This box is more reliable than DSG-7, and is better suited for long distances. But for the city it’s optimal 1.4 TSI with mechanics - it is more economical and easier to repair.
On the secondary market of Bashkortostan, the most popular configurations are Ambition and Style. They are easier to sell in the future, and spare parts for them are always available in local services.
Typical tricks of sellers on Avito Bashkortostan and how to recognize them
Sellers at Avito Bashkortostan often use psychological tricks to sell problematic Škoda Octavia more expensive. We have collected 5 most common tricks and ways to get around them:
- 📸 "Photo from the salon": If the pictures show a perfectly clean interior and body, but there is no photo below or under the hood, this is a reason to be wary. Ask for additional photos or videos of problem areas (for example,
DSGor pendants). - 🗓️ “The car just arrived, I’m selling it urgently”: Classic trick of resellers. A real owner rarely sells a car “urgently” without a reason. Ask why you need to get rid of your car so quickly.
- 🔧 “Everything is done, just fill it up and drive”: If the seller claims that “everything has been replaced,” ask for receipts. Without documents, such statements are worthless. For example, replacing the timing chain with 1.8 TSI costs 30–40 thousand rubles - it is unlikely that they did it “just like that.”
- 💰 “The price is below the market because money is urgently needed”: In fact, a below-market price usually means hidden problems. Compare the offer with similar ones on Avito - if the difference is more than 10%, this is a reason for suspicion.
- 📄 “Everything according to the agreement, without deception”: In Bashkortostan, up to 30% of transactions are executed under a general power of attorney, which is fraught with risks (for example, a car may be pledged). Insist on standard PrEP.

💰 Is it worth taking an Octavia with a mileage of more than 200 thousand km?
It depends on the engine and service history:
- 🚗 1.6 MPI: It can travel 300 thousand km with regular oil changes, but it will be “dumb” and gluttonous (consumption 9–11 l/100 km).
- ⚡ 1.4/1.8 TSI: Risky - after 200 thousand km, the turbine, timing chain or oil pump often needs to be replaced.
- 🔧 2.0 TDI: Diesels are more durable than gasoline ones, but in Bashkortostan it is difficult to work with them (few craftsmen, expensive spare parts).
💡 Recommendation: If you take a car with 200 thousand km mileage, be sure to:
- Swipe engine endoscopy (cost in Ufa - 1,500 rubles).
- Check the compression in the cylinders (the norm for TSI is 12–14 bar).
- Make sure
DSGdoes not “kick” and there are no errors in the box.
📄 What documents need to be checked before purchasing?
Minimum set:
- PTS: Check that there are no marks about a deposit or duplicate. The "Owners" column should contain no more than 2-3 entries.
- STS: Check the VIN and license plate number with the data in the vehicle title.
- Sales and purchase agreement: Only the original, no corrections. In Bashkortostan, scammers often forge DCTs - check the watermarks.
- Service book: There must be stamps every 15 thousand km. If you don't have the book, ask for receipts or records from the dealership.
⚠️ Attention: If the seller says that “the documents are in the bank” or “the vehicle is lost,” it is better to refuse the transaction. In Bashkortostan, cases of selling cars as collateral have become more frequent (especially through Avito).
